		</div><p>The European Union will allow members to restrict sales of inflatable boats and outboard motors to Libya in an effort to stop dangerous migrant smuggling across the Mediterranean.</p>
<p>EU foreign ministers have agreed to allow member countries to ban such exports or supply &#8220;where there are reasonable grounds to believe that they will be used by people smugglers and human traffickers&#8221;.</p>
<p>A statement said the measure will also apply to boats and motors transiting through the EU, but not to fishermen or others with legitimate need for them.</p>
<p>The foreign ministers also agreed to extend a border aid mission in Libya through to the end of 2018 that helps Libyan security forces, notably in the lawless south.</p>
<p>Migrant crossings from Libya to Italy on unsafe boats have climbed in recent weeks.</p>
